How does a Remote Assistant Editor typically collaborate with the post-production team to ensure smooth workflow?

As a Remote Assistant Editor, you will frequently interact with editors, producers, and other post-production staff via digital collaboration tools. Your responsibilities often include organizing footage, syncing audio and video, preparing project files, and managing file transfers to keep the editing process on track. Strong communication skills and proficiency with cloud-based platforms are essential to quickly address any workflow bottlenecks. While working remotely offers flexibility, it also requires proactive coordination to ensure everyone is aligned on project timelines and deliverables.

What are Remote Assistant Editors?

Remote Assistant Editors are professionals who support the post-production process of films, television shows, or digital content from a remote location. Their responsibilities often include organizing footage, syncing audio and video, preparing project files for editors, managing media assets, and ensuring all technical aspects of editing run smoothly. They collaborate with editors and production teams using cloud-based tools and secure file-sharing platforms. This role requires strong technical skills, attention to detail, and effective communication, as well as familiarity with industry-standard editing software. Remote Assistant Editors play a crucial part in keeping the editing workflow efficient and organized, even when working from different locations.

Founded in 1989, SOSi is among the largest private, founder-owned technology and services integrators in the defense and government services industry. We deliver tailored solutions, tested leadership, and trusted results to enable national security missions worldwide.
Job Description
Overview
**This position is contingent upon award of contract**
SOS International LLC (SOSi) is seeking an Editor to support a US Government Client. The Editor will be the final quality control for translations and serial products before dissemination. The Editor will support a larger team and will be the authoritative expert of the Client stye-guide.
Essential Job Duties
  • Ensure all products are grammatically correct according to idiomatic American English and customer's standards.
  • Apply Client style-guide, including standardized spellings for people and places.
  • Serve as a resource for team members regarding Client style guide and general American grammar.
  • Apply substantive and linguistic knowledge of target issue areas.

Qualifications
Minimum Requirements
  • High School Diploma.
  • 3 years of relevant experience, including editing work of linguists/translators.
  • Experience with supporting programs of similar size and scope.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Teams, Excel, and Word.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ills, ability to engage collaboratively and effectively in a virtual environment within a diverse team.
  • Strong time and task management skills.

Preferred Qualifications
  • Bachelor's Degree and one year of relevant experience.
  • Experience supporting the Intelligence Community (IC).
  • Experience editing work of linguists, including translation of foreign media materials and machine translations.
